Reports Q1 revenue $3.41B, consensus $3.38B. “Our first quarter results reflect PulteGroup’s (PHM) ability to successfully navigate current market conditions as we work to meet buyer demand, turn our assets and drive high returns,” said PulteGroup President and CEO Ryan Marshall. “Along with increased net new orders, we generated strong closings, revenues and earnings, while investing $1.3 billion into land acquisition and development and returning $360 million back to shareholders. “Within a demand environment impacted by domestic and global dynamics, we see a consumer with concerns about affordability and the economy, but still desirous of homeownership as demonstrated by the 3% growth in our first quarter net new orders,” added Marshall. “Given these dynamics, we continue to intelligently manage sales, incentives and production to best position the Company for near- and long-term success.”
